Abstract

The data on the composition, structure and dynamics of phytoplankton in morphologically different tributaries of the Cheboksary reservoir (the Vetluga, Kerzhenets and Vishnya rivers) are given. The floristic composition of algae includes 856 species and intraspecific taxa, algoflora is characterized as diatom-green-euglena algae. There is an increase in quantitative indicators of algocenosises from oligotrophic to oligotrophic-mesotrophic level in the middle course of the rivers, with mesotrophic-eutrophic level in the estuaries. The period of abnormally hot summer in 2010 led to increasing of vegetation of blue-green and dinophyte algae in the middle course and estuaries of the rivers. Since the early 2000s, penetration and naturalization of invasive algae species has been noted.
